On-Site Tire Installation Steps

Mobile tire services streamline the tire installation process by bringing professional assistance directly to the customer's location. Upon arrival, technicians evaluate the vehicle and tire requirements, ensuring the right tires are available. They initiate the installation by taking off the existing tires and inspecting the wheel assembly for any damage. After thorough checks, new tires are installed and aligned, securing peak performance. Technicians also examine the vehicle's alignment and inflate the tires to the manufacturer's recommended pressure. Once the installation is complete, they provide guidance on maintenance and care for the new tires. Service Expenses Breakdown

A detailed examination of service fees highlights distinct differences between mobile tire services and traditional shops. Mobile tire services generally charge a premium for the convenience of on-site assistance, including fees that often cover travel costs and labor. These services may cost between $75 and $150, depending on the task's level of challenge. Conversely, traditional shops tend to offer lower base prices for tire mounting and balancing, with averages around $20 to $50 per tire. Yet, customers need to consider additional charges for transportation and possible waiting times. While mobile services provide unsurpassed convenience, traditional shops offer a more inexpensive alternative for those willing to make the trip. Ultimately, the decision relies on personal preferences and priorities related to cost and convenience.
